Closing out 2006… by the numbers

I started blogging back in September 2005. There have been a few weeks where I went silent throughout 2006, but nonetheless, 227 posts later, I’m closing out the big ’06. The goal of this blog is to stimulate conversation amongst my friends and peers but providing thought provoking information in readily accessible methods.

Each day, I’m wrapped up in the video game and advertising space. However, my interests and knowledge extends far beyond the in-game advertising space and dealing with IGA Worldwide, and I use DarrenHerman.com to talk about other areas that fascinate me.

In 2006 alone, (mostly in Q3/Q4 when I got serious about my blog), I had over 10,500 unique visitors and delivered around 21,000 pageviews (according to SiteMeter). In no means is this a high traffic destination site, but it’s certainly increasing over time and my month over month traffic has steadily increased. With the 10,500 unique users and 227 posts, I’ve had over 200 comments on the blog, most of which have come in Q3/Q4. Not bad for getting readers engaged….
